Tournament Wrap-up
four months, thousands of votes, 72 constants and we have a winner! i had a lot of fun running this, and i hope everyone had fun participating. my goal here was to celebrate Canadian media, which often gets swept under the rug in the heavily American (and to a lesser extent British) popular culture. maybe this inspired you (as it inspired me!) to read a new book or watch a new movie, and if it did, it's a success in my book.
there will be a second tournament at some point in the future, and i will be recruiting more mods then, because i think a bigger tournament with more indie media brought into the spotlight would be really great. it was just me this time, because i honestly didn't think people would really care and i didn't want to bother anyone else.

I went to a “Cancel Canada Day” event and burst into tears - not because I was surprised to learn of the unmarked graves (survivors told us they were there. Our government pushed it aside, and we let them), but because seeing all the people gathered in mourning drove it home: They. Were. Children.
This is my country’s legacy - and it’s not history. The last schools closed during my lifetime. My Father went to school with students who lived at the local residential school, after it was changed to a boarding house (read: holding centre) for indigenous youth who went to local schools.
They were all children, injured, abused, and killed in my country’s attempt to erase them. I want the world to see this and hold the state accountable to *active* reconciliation> I mean we could at least truly adopt UNDRIP in action instead of words for god’s sake.

Fictional Canadian Showdown: FINAL ROUND
Anne Shirley, Anne of Green Gables
Toriko Nishina, Otherside Picnic
This is it folks! The round you've all been waiting for, the time we decide who is the ULTIMATE FICTIONAL CANADIAN.
It's been a tough battle. We have had over 70 contestants, spanning every province and territory expect the Northwest Territories. They've covered a variety of different mediums, from webcomics to video games to movies to poetry and more. Our oldest came from a poem published in 1847, while we also had one from a currently updating webcomic.
Of those figures, some towering figures of Canadiana, some more unknown (that I hope this blog helped get them a tiny little smidge of much deserved limelight) only two remain. Those are:
Anne Shirley is from Anne of Green Gables, a book by Lucy Maude Montgomery that has been turned into everything from a ballet to an animated children’s tv show. Anne has multiple museums, a theme park, two stamps from Canada Post and is a cornerstone of PEI’s tourism industry.
Anne is fanciful, imaginative, eager to please, and dramatic. She is also adamant her name should always be spelt with an "e" at the end
And
Toriko Nishina (blonde) is from Otherside Picnic a novel series/anime. From submitter: Silly lesbian who explores an alternate world full of internet creepypasta with her gf. knows a lot about guns. has two moms.

Fictional Canadian Showdown: Round Four
Meilin "Mei" Lee, Turning Red
George Crabtree, Murdoch Mysteries
Show Results
Meilin "Mei" Lee is from Turning Red, an animated flim. She is a 13-year-old Chinese-Canadian from Toronto who turns into a red panda when she experience strong emotions due to a hereditary curse.
George Crabtree is from Murdoch Mysteries, a tv show on CBC. He is a young constable who's eager to be a detective like Murdoch, but lacks the formal education to do so. Murdoch admires his enthusiasm, openness to new ideas and loyalty, but is frustrated by Crabtree's inability to grasp some of the more elusive scientific concepts
